💻 Hardware: Procesoare pentru calculator (CPU)

Imagine: 💻 Hardware: Procesoare pentru calculator (CPU)

💻 Hardware: Procesoare pentru calculator (CPU)

Procesorul, sau CPU (Central Processing Unit), este inima unui computer, responsabil pentru executarea instrucțiunilor programelor și coordonarea tuturor componentelor hardware. Performanța unui procesor este esențială pentru funcționarea eficientă a unui sistem și poate varia semnificativ în funcție de mai multe caracteristici, cum ar fi numărul de nuclee și thread-uri, frecvența de operare și memoria cache.

Memoria Cache și Nivelurile acesteia

Memoria cache este o formă de memorie rapidă situată pe procesor, utilizată pentru a stoca temporar datele și instrucțiunile accesate frecvent, reducând astfel timpul necesar pentru a accesa datele din memoria principală (RAM). Memoria cache este organizată pe mai multe niveluri, fiecare având propriile caracteristici și scopuri:

Tipuri de memorie cache:

Numărul de Nuclee și Thread-uri

Numărul de nuclee și thread-uri este un factor crucial care determină performanța unui procesor. Fiecare nucleu poate executa instrucțiuni independent, iar thread-urile (firele de execuție) reprezintă sarcinile pe care procesorul le poate gestiona simultan. Cu cât un procesor are mai multe nuclee și thread-uri, cu atât poate gestiona mai eficient sarcini multiple și poate oferi o performanță mai bună în aplicații paralele.

Caracteristici ale nucleelor și thread-urilor:

Thread-urile sunt gestionate de tehnologia Hyper-Threading de la Intel sau Simultaneous Multithreading (SMT) de la AMD, permițând fiecărui nucleu să proceseze două thread-uri simultan, astfel îmbunătățind performanța în aplicațiile multithreaded.

Frecvența de Operare

Frecvența de operare, sau viteza ceasului, este măsurată în gigaherți (GHz) și indică numărul de cicluri pe secundă pe care un procesor le poate executa. O frecvență mai mare înseamnă că procesorul poate executa mai multe instrucțiuni într-o perioadă de timp, ceea ce poate îmbunătăți performanța. Cu toate acestea, frecvența nu este singurul factor care determină performanța unui procesor, eficiența arhitecturii și numărul de nuclee fiind la fel de importante.

Tipuri de frecvențe:

ryzen cpu

Arhitectura Procesorului

Arhitectura procesorului se referă la designul intern și tehnologia folosită în construcția acestuia. Diferitele arhitecturi pot oferi performanțe și eficiență energetică variate. De exemplu, arhitectura x86 de la Intel și AMD este comună în computerele desktop și laptop, în timp ce arhitectura ARM este utilizată pe scară largă în dispozitive mobile datorită eficienței sale energetice.

Exemple de arhitecturi:

TDP (Thermal Design Power)

TDP reprezintă cantitatea maximă de căldură pe care un procesor o poate genera și care trebuie disipată de sistemul de răcire pentru a menține funcționarea normală. Un TDP mai mare înseamnă că procesorul necesită un sistem de răcire mai eficient și consumă mai multă energie. Alegerea unui procesor cu un TDP adecvat este crucială pentru stabilitatea și eficiența sistemului.

Comparatie între Procesoarele Intel și AMD

Procesoarele Intel sunt cunoscute pentru performanța lor pe nucleu și frecvențele turbo ridicate, fiind adesea preferate pentru jocuri și aplicații care nu sunt optimizate pentru utilizarea multor nuclee. Intel oferă tehnologii precum Hyper-Threading și Turbo Boost pentru a îmbunătăți performanța și eficiența procesorului.

Procesoarele AMD au câștigat popularitate datorită raportului excelent între preț și performanță, oferind mai multe nuclee și thread-uri la prețuri competitive. Arhitectura Zen de la AMD a adus îmbunătățiri semnificative în performanță și eficiență energetică, făcându-le o alegere excelentă pentru multitasking și aplicații paralele. Tehnologiile precum SMT (Simultaneous Multithreading) și Precision Boost contribuie la optimizarea performanței.

În concluzie, alegerea procesorului potrivit depinde de nevoile și bugetul utilizatorului. Pentru gaming și aplicații single-threaded, procesoarele Intel pot oferi un avantaj, în timp ce pentru sarcini multithreaded și raportul preț-performanță, procesoarele AMD sunt adesea preferate. Înțelegerea caracteristicilor precum memoria cache, numărul de nuclee și thread-uri, frecvența de operare și arhitectura poate ajuta utilizatorii să facă alegerea optimă pentru sistemul lor.

Andrei Frîntu
Andrei Frîntu

Fondatorul platformei - mentor Academia

LinkedIn Instagram GitHub
© Copyright 2024 - CodulLuiAndrei.ro - Toate drepturile sunt rezervate